掃描下載 Gate App
qrCode
更多下載方式
今天不再提醒

分散式系統:幕後無形的基礎設施

robot
摘要生成中

你曾經想過Netflix是如何向數百萬人傳輸電影而不崩潰嗎?或者比特幣是如何在沒有中央銀行的情況下驗證交易的?答案就在於分散式系統

什麼是分散式系統?

想像一下,不是使用一台超級電腦,而是數千台普通電腦一起工作。這基本上就是分散式系統:多台獨立的機器相互通信,讓用戶感覺像是在與一個單一系統互動。

(不無聊的運作方式)

1. 分工合作 → 複雜的任務被拆分成較小的部分,分配給不同的節點。

2. 相互通信 → 節點之間使用TCP/IP或HTTP等協議交換資訊。

3. 協調行動 → 使用共識算法和協議來同步,就像區塊鏈一樣。

4. 不易崩潰 → 如果某個節點失效,其他節點會接管其功能,系統仍能正常運作。

令人喜愛的優點

擴展性:需要更多運算能力?加入更多機器。很簡單。

可靠性:如果某部分出問題,系統仍持續運作。

性能:由於負載分散,處理速度更快。

真實的缺點

✗ 協調多個節點較為複雜,尤其是它們分布在不同國家時。

✗ 同步問題可能導致資料不一致。

✗ 需要專業知識,成本也會增加。

主要類型

客戶端-伺服器 → 你的瀏覽器(客戶端)向伺服器請求資料。這是網路上最常見的架構。

點對點(P2P) → 所有節點平等。像BitTorrent就是這樣運作。

區塊鏈 → 分散式資料庫,每個節點都擁有完整的副本。比特幣就是典型例子。

分散式資料庫 → 資料在多個伺服器間分散存放。社交媒體和電子商務平台常用。

未來趨勢:叢集與網格計算

叢集計算(Clustering)——多台機器連結成一個整體,成本逐漸降低,將成為大規模資料處理、人工智慧和機器學習的關鍵。

網格計算(Grid Computing)——地理上分散的資源整合,預計能民主化計算能力,從比特幣挖礦池到科學研究合作都會受益。

核心特點:透明性

令人驚喜的是,這一切都在“引擎蓋下”運作。用戶看不到背後的複雜性。你在Google搜尋,幾毫秒就得到結果,卻不知道有數千台伺服器在為你工作。


加密貨幣相關背景:區塊鏈可能是最具革命性的分散式系統。每個節點都持有完整的帳本副本,確保透明、安全,且抗審查。沒有中央伺服器,也沒有單點故障。

BTC0.91%
查看原文
此頁面可能包含第三方內容,僅供參考(非陳述或保證),不應被視為 Gate 認可其觀點表述,也不得被視為財務或專業建議。詳見聲明
  • 讚賞
  • 留言
  • 轉發
  • 分享
留言
0/400
暫無留言
交易,隨時隨地
qrCode
掃碼下載 Gate App
社群列表
繁體中文
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)